Ingredients

4 cups flour
1 tsp baking soda
1 tsp salt
2 cups buttermilk

Instructions

1
Preheat oven to 350 degreeโ€™s.
2
Combine all dry ingredients and whisk together to combine.
3
Add the buttermilk to form a sticky dough. Place on a floured work surface and gently knead.
4
Shape into a round and place onto a baking sheet sprayed with vegetable spray. Cut a cross into the top of the bread.
5
Bake for approximately 45 minutes or until golden brown.
